Default amatuer radio astronomy

I have a 1.2 meter offset sat dish and a 0.2dB LNB head.
So far all i get is the sun (at +9dB) and the moon (at +0.7dB). These
mesuarments are refered to quite sky.
Ground noise is 5dB.
Can I expect to get anything else? Or must I get a larger antenna?
